Transaction 80343fd9a7af39386fd54701fef778b905a16f943606f0a516cf8a85143d91fb

14 Input
2 Outputs
  • 80343fd9a7af39386fd54701fef778b905a16f943606f0a516cf8a85143d91fb:0
  • value  27165
    address  bc1qeca5cu98ffhslyx3xsnwurzys8xmz3vxxpra0g
  • 80343fd9a7af39386fd54701fef778b905a16f943606f0a516cf8a85143d91fb:1
  • value  1234681
    address  19sqmVDFUEBG8JmahKkLat3Cd3nDNvNxDR